Job Description

Preparing daily position and trade reconciliations between clients’ books and records and their Prime Brokers’

Working with clients and prime brokers on trade break resolutions

Preparing monthly tri-party position, cash, market value and accrual reconciliations

Preparing monthly performance estimates for COO clients

Review monthly Administrator NAV Packages and make updates to the portfolio accounting system if necessary

Build and maintain fund accrual schedules

Processing Corporate Actions for securities held in client portfolios, including cash and stock dividends, stock splits, and mergers and acquisitions

Providing support for the conversion of new clients (middle office), including providing training to clients on technology and processes
